Just How Roofing Air Flow Functions
Effective roof ventilation counts on the all-natural movement of air to produce an equilibrium between consumption and exhaust. When you install vents, you're basically allowing fresh air to enter your attic while making it possible for warm, stale air to escape. This procedure helps regulate temperature and moisture levels, stopping problems like mold and mildew growth and roofing system damage.
Intake vents, commonly discovered at the eaves, reel in cool air from outside. At the same time, exhaust vents, located near the ridge of the roof covering, allow hot air surge and exit. The difference in temperature creates a natural airflow, referred to as the stack impact. As warm air rises, it develops a vacuum cleaner that draws in cooler air from the lower vents.
To optimize this system, you need to ensure that the consumption and exhaust vents are appropriately sized and positioned. If the intake is limited, you won't attain the preferred air flow.
Likewise, inadequate exhaust can catch heat and wetness, leading to potential damages.
